Spline AI - Pros & Cons
Pros
- ✓Browser-based platform requires no software downloads or installations
- ✓Real-time collaboration allows multiple team members to work simultaneously on projects
- ✓No-code approach makes 3D design accessible to designers without 3D modeling experience
- ✓Cross-platform exports work seamlessly on web, iOS, and Android applications
- ✓Intuitive interface with familiar design tools reduces learning curve for graphic designers
- ✓Active community with template library provides starting points for common use cases
- ✓Built-in optimization ensures 3D assets perform well on web platforms
Cons
- ✗AI features produce inconsistent results and struggle with complex or intricate design requirements
- ✗Limited professional-grade 3D modeling capabilities compared to desktop alternatives like Blender or Cinema 4D
- ✗Performance depends heavily on browser capabilities and internet connection stability
- ✗Webflow and other popular web builder integrations have reported compatibility issues
- ✗Billing transparency concerns and complex cancellation processes reported by users
- ✗AI texture generation and style transfer features often produce distorted or unusable outputs
Meshy AI - Pros & Cons
Pros
- ✓Industry-leading generation speed with consistent sub-60-second results for production-ready 3D models
- ✓Enterprise-grade security with SOC2 Type II and GDPR certifications ensuring professional data protection
- ✓Production-ready output with automatic PBR texturing, UV mapping, and optimized topology requiring no manual cleanup
- ✓Comprehensive API infrastructure supporting up to 100 requests per second for enterprise workflow integration
- ✓Active plugin ecosystem with native Unity and Blender integration maintaining material properties across platforms
- ✓Advanced rigging and animation capabilities with 500+ pre-built animations beyond basic geometry generation
Cons
- ✗Limited fine-tuning control over specific geometric details and proportions compared to manual 3D modeling workflows
- ✗Credit-based pricing model can become expensive for high-volume production usage with frequent asset generation
- ✗AI interpretation may not always match precise creative specifications requiring iterative prompt refinement
